Transaction 64cbda349d8f537e44121fa61b5e1a377146ddb2b2c08acbd01a260fd7b23406

149 Input
2 Outputs
  • 64cbda349d8f537e44121fa61b5e1a377146ddb2b2c08acbd01a260fd7b23406:0
  • value  4000000000
    address  13UA4pAmFtEE4nptYHvRZ4Zp8Uck2VBWoo
  • 64cbda349d8f537e44121fa61b5e1a377146ddb2b2c08acbd01a260fd7b23406:1
  • value  32720844
    address  3Gd8DRPWrzd8oVEX1n8UjpDf2rkE9dakeb